'Robbed of sight, I have a vision to help the blind see'
By Vivienne Nunis Business reporter, BBC News
    26 February 2017
 
A blind man who narrowly escaped death when he was gunned down in the Philippines has developed software he hopes will offer life-changing independence to blind people.

Marx Melencio was buying fried rice with his wife at a roadside store in Manila when he was shot in the chest and the head in an apparently random attack.

The first bullet hit him 3mm from his heart. The second missed his brain by 2mm but singed his optic nerve, rendering him blind.

Witnesses say the man who fired the gun was under the influence of both alcohol and drugs, but he's never been convicted.
